Police in Osun State have confirmed the killing of one person in a shooting incident in Osogbo, shortly after Governor Ademola Adeleke and his nephew, Nigerian music star David Adeleke, popularly known as Davido, visited the palace of the Ataoja of Osogbo.
The victim, identified as 60-year-old Tajudeen Yusuf of Oke-Ayepe, Osogbo, was allegedly shot by suspected hoodlums at Itaolokan area of the state capital on Wednesday.
The Osun State Police Command, in a statement issued by its Public Relations Officer, DSP Abiodun Ojelabi, said the incident occurred at about 4pm.
According to the police, trouble started after a suspected ex-convict and alleged member of the Eiye Confraternity, Adebayo Taoreed, popularly known as “Small Rugged,” attempted to gain access to Davido but was resisted by members of his security team.
The confrontation reportedly drew other suspected gang members, who temporarily blocked the palace entrance and obstructed the movement of the governor’s convoy before it eventually left the area safely.
The police said the suspected gang members later departed the vicinity but allegedly shot Yusuf at Itaolokan.
A police patrol team rushed to the scene after receiving the report and found the victim in a pool of blood.
He was taken to the University Teaching Hospital, Osogbo, where doctors pronounced him dead.
The Commissioner of Police (Election), Osun State Command, CP Samuel Etaifo, condemned the killing and ordered a full-scale investigation, assuring that the perpetrators would be identified, arrested and brought to justice.
The command also appealed to members of the public with relevant information to contact the nearest police station or the command through its official channels.
It urged residents to remain calm and avoid taking the law into their own hands, assuring that further updates would be released as the investigation progresses.
